The Mill Owners Company LLC are seeking a final site plan and special permit to renovate “the mansion” on Glenville Street and build 15 rental apartments plus 23 parking spaces in the area residents refer to as “the green.” The application was opened at the Tuesday Planning & Zoning commission meeting. The property is in the Local Business Zone. It is in a Historic Overlay zone, and is also in a Registered Historic District. The Greenwich Planning & Zoning Commission approved a 7-unit residential apartment building at 103 Mason Street, where many will remember the Computer Super Center operated for many years. The applicant is 103 Mason Street LLC, which is registered to Brian Derosier, according to the CT Secretary of the State website. The structure will be 3-story and a total of 15,369 sq ft. The breakdown of units is: two 2-bedroom units and five 3-bedroom units. One of the 2-bedroom units will be designated for moderate income under the town’s 6-110 regulation. Continue Reading →
